Output 35a8570607947c6d4b7403b2619222b61221acbb4647c321c100d9de85037109:4

value
18812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78970fcae54fdf29570f51769215d39f151e66b1 OP_EQUAL
address
3CgdyWk3DWz2oAAnRGhsMPmSczE8gbM7wn
transaction
35a8570607947c6d4b7403b2619222b61221acbb4647c321c100d9de85037109
spent
true